Research Associate Proposes African Cities Governance Award

A governance award for African cities can promote positive change in fragile and low-income states, says OEF Research's Victor Odundo Owuor on The Fragile States Resource Center.

African cities are endowed with a diversity of innovation and ideas, but can encounter the full gamut of challenges from transport, to energy, water, and sanitation. When cities are well-planned and managed appropriately, they can help address infrastructure deficits tied to fragile economies. OEF Research's Victor Odundo Owuor believes that showcasing how successful local governments in Africa are driving change can generate the motivation and inspiration to work towards the same or higher achievements.
